Web28 aug. 2024 · To create an empty DataFrame is as simple as: import pandas as pd dataFrame1 = pd.DataFrame () We will take a look at how you can add rows and … Web24 feb. 2024 · If you try the following. # file1.py def foo (): print ("foo") # file2.py from file1 import foo foo () and then run python file2.py in the folder next to file1.py and … Web12 mei 2024 · pandas has two main data structures: Series and DataFrame. Series: a 1-dimensional labeled array that can hold any data type such as integers, strings, floating points, Python objects. It has row/axis labels as the index. WebLoading data from a CSV file: To load data from a CSV (Comma Separated Values) file, you can use the read_csv () function: import pandas as pd data = pd.read_csv('filename.csv') Replace ‘filename.csv’ with the path to your CSV file. The resulting data variable is a DataFrame containing the data from the CSV file.
